Output e04c623879cc9572d07ae927df3bfe643e0b1306df9d54a8bc69bac3107755bf:0

value
1866600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8790b8f66780808d087052326c74be355557bf OP_EQUAL
address
3EbMbqR6poYKsRMoUnWZZkJEhjjnWFRVQk
transaction
e04c623879cc9572d07ae927df3bfe643e0b1306df9d54a8bc69bac3107755bf
spent
true